Prison Break: The Breakthrough Role

When Wentworth Miller landed the role of Michael Scofield in Prison Break, little did he know it would change his life forever. The show, which premiered in 2005, became a global phenomenon, thanks in large part to Miller’s portrayal of the intelligent and resourceful engineer who breaks into prison to save his brother.

Prison Break wasn’t just a show—it was a cultural phenomenon that redefined the prison drama genre. Miller’s performance earned him critical acclaim and a legion of fans who were captivated by his character’s brilliance and determination. It was this role that solidified his place in Hollywood and paved the way for future opportunities.

Wentworth Miller The Flash: Captain Cold’s Story

Fast forward to 2014, and Wentworth Miller found himself in another groundbreaking role—Leonard Snart, aka Captain Cold, in The Flash. At first, fans were skeptical about how Miller would fit into the DC universe, but he quickly silenced any doubts with his nuanced portrayal of the anti-hero.
